- The distance between West Chester, Pa, Usa and Auckland Airport, New Zealand is approximately 14,013 km or 8,708 mi.
- To reach West Chester, Pa in this distance one would set out from Auckland Airport bearing 63.4° or ENE and follow the great circles arc to approach West Chester, Pa bearing 68.8° or ENE .
- West Chester, Pa has a humid subtropical climate (Cfa) whereas Auckland Airport has a marine west coast climate (Cfb).
- West Chester, Pa is in or near the cool temperate moist forest biome whereas Auckland Airport is in or near the warm temperate dry forest biome.
- The mean temperature is 3.5 °C (6.3°F) cooler.
- Average monthly temperatures vary by 15.9 °C (28.6°F) more in West Chester, Pa. The continentality subtype is subcontinental as opposed to barely hyperoceanic.
- Total annual precipitation averages 28.7 mm (1.1 in) more which is equivalent to 28.7 l/m² (0.7 US gal/ft²) or 287,000 l/ha (30,682 US gal/ac) more. About 1 as much.
- The altitude of the sun at midday is overall 2.3° lower in West Chester, Pa than in Auckland Airport.
